1 Benefits and Lessons Learned from Implementation of the Information Business System within the Public Service for Institutional Radwaste Management ABSTRACT S. Sučić, M. Fabjan, M. Kostanjevec ARAO - Agency for Radwaste Management Parmova 53, SI-1000 Ljubljana, Slovenia simona.sucic@gov.si, marija.fabjan@gov.si, marko.kostanjevec@gov.si At the end of 2007 the Slovenian Agency for Radwaste Management (ARAO) had been upgraded its performance of public service for the institutional radioactive waste management by the contemporary tailor-made Information Business System; called JSMP application. The tailor-made application was developed within European Union (EU) funded project called Improvement of the management of institutional radioactive waste in Slovenia via the design and implementation of the Information Business System with the aim to improve the entire process of public service for institutional radwaste management in Slovenia. The first version of the JSMP application was developed within six months by close co-operation of radwaste and information technology (IT) experts. At the end the entire organization has been mobilized with the one aim: providing a higher standard of quality management of institutional radioactive waste in Slovenia. After more than three years of usage, the JSMP application has become necessary tool in the ARAO working process and it has been used as a support during automatic generation of forms, reports and various analyses for different purposes, data tracking, transparency, different overviews and working on different locations. Within this paper, practical issues, benefits and lessons learned from the implementation of the information business system within the public service for institutional radwaste management are presented. Also, design of JSMP application, its functionality and mechanisms for data tracking and transparency are described. INTRODUCTION The task of public service for institutional radioactive waste management in Slovenia was assigned to the Agency for Radwaste Management (ARAO) by the Governmental Decree of May 1999 [1] [2]. From the beginning the public service of institutional radioactive waste management became one of ARAO s main and the most important business processes. This task ranges from the collection of the waste at users' premises to the storage in the Central Storage Facility (CSF) and afterwards disposal in the planned Low and Intermediate Level Waste (LILW) repository. The scope of the managing of institutional radioactive waste also includes waste transport, operation of the CSF, treatment and conditioning of stored waste. With the aim of achieving a higher efficiency in performing the public service ARAO decided to develop the software package that links all activities of the institutional radioactive waste management process into one management system. The software package called JSMP application was developed and implemented in 2007 by the group of IT experts from 707.1

2 707.2 Slovenian well-known IT company with close cooperation of radwaste experts from Belgium and ARAO. At 1 st of January 2008, after two months of filling the database with historical data, ARAO has started to use the JSMP application. DESIGN AND FUNCTIONALITIES OF JSMP APPLICATION The JSMP application is the name of the tailor-made software package specialized for supporting the ARAO business process related with the institutional radwaste management. It enables the ARAO employees to track, search and view the data from databases via secured internet access from different locations. As a software development life-cycle methodology the Waterfall methodology was used. The main reason for choosing this methodology is its simple approach: analyse the problem, design the solution, implement the code, test the code, integrate and deploy. ARAO's main requirements for development and implementation of JSMP application were the following [3]: One-time data entering, Use of one single database, Access to waste management data from different locations, Simple search of the stored data, Storage of all documents in one place, that are easily accessible, Traceability of the data about radwaste, Disabling further data correction once after the content of entered data has been confirmed. With the aim to assure long-term functionality the JSMP application was designed in the way that enables [4]: Loosely coupled applications, where one service can be relatively simply replaced by another, Possibility of creating new applications by orchestrating and reusing existing services, Possibility of demonstrating the business service to external business partners, Reducing the complexity of distributed applications, Possibility of future extensions by modular design. The JSMP application supports the following activities of the institutional radwaste management: Processing the takeover order, Takeover of waste packages at the waste producers premises, Transport of waste, Waste acceptance in the storage facility, Waste storage, treatment and conditioning, Invoicing the takeover services, Transfer of waste ownership. Beside support the institutional radwaste management business process, JSMP application also supports additional activities like the preparation of the annual reports for the Central register of radioactive waste (CERAO) about the stored waste in xml code or reacceptation of waste packages after treatment and conditioning activities. Also, it is possible to export the data from the JSMP application to MS Excel format or any other format which is more user friendly for analyses.

3 707.3 Services that cover above mentioned activities within the JSMP application are: Waste Takeover service that supports business process from issuing the order to actual reception of the waste at the storage facility. Waste Acceptance service that supports the business process from the point when the waste package has entered to the storage facility. This service is responsible for the preparation of invoice requests and tracking the invoice request status. It is planned that this service will be upgraded and connected to the ARAO financial system; to automatically issue invoices and track the invoice status. When the invoice is paid, this service is also responsible for preparing the statement for transfer of ownership of the radwaste from waste producer to ARAO. Storage Facility Management service that supports tasks related to the Storage Facility. It is responsible for storing the received waste package to storage location defined by the user, for tracking the waste package movements, alerting the user if the position is already occupied and managing the storage facility positions. This service is also responsible for preparing the reports on the stored radioactive waste. Application supports the calculation of the current activity of the waste package. It is planned that this service will be upgraded with the new so called notification alert which will inform the administrator when the activity of the certain waste package fall below clearance level.

4 707.4 Figure 1: Model of Business process [4] The JSMP aplication is a system that enables its users, physically located on different locations, and secured internet access to the documents and data, stored in the databases. It was developed as a web application in Microsoft.NET Framework technology. Beside the regular paper copies additional weekly backups of the database content has been preformed. The JSMP consists from the following modules [4]: Registration module, which enables the registering in the system using digital certificates of registered Slovenian certification agencies. Without the qualified digital certificates, it is impossible to ensure conformity with the Slovenian electronic business legislation.

5 707.5 Administration module, which has been designed for system users vested with the rights of administrator. The different roles of an administrator include user administrator, document administrator and system administrator. Mediation module, designed for connecting and coordinating actions executed by other modules. Document module, designed for defining documents, document workflow and document validity. Security module that provides protection against viruses and executes electronic signature and document time stamping. It also contains an e-signature tool for verification of signed electronic documents on the local computer. Logging module, which is a database containing all information on registered users of the system and on signed electronic documents, the associated code tables, the records of all actions in the system etc. The table below represents the functionalities that JSMP application covers. 7 707.7 Figure 2: A few JSMP application screenshots: the data inserting masks, documents and reports generating from the JSMP application [5] BENEFITS AND LESSONS LEARNED After three years of using the JSMP application its effectiveness can be fully identified and analyzed. There is no doubt that this application was a key element of ARAO s activities to improve the efficiency of the functioning of the institutional radioactive waste management and ensured better standards for radioactive waste management in Slovenia that comply with the requests from the Regulatory Authority. The main benefits of the JSMP application usage in the ARAO are [6]: There is no confusion about the process definition any more. The institutional radioactive waste management is uniformed and optimized. The transparency of the whole process is archived by clear definition of all activities. The transfer of BAT (best available technologies) in the field of institutional radioactive waste management from EU countries to Slovenia was enabled by the support of skilled experts with the radioactive waste management experience in EU countries. One-time data entering, possibilities to search, export or prepare reports about data enable users to fully utilize its working time.

8 707.8 Due to less work needed for the administration (consecution of JSMP application) the operative costs of work have been decreased. Usage of one single database (JSMP application) and possibility to access to the waste management data from different locations allow all users to access data easily from different locations. Due to traceability of the waste management data, users have insight into whole management process, from takeover and acceptance till the reception of the package in the storage facility and eventual removing of the package from the storage facility. The results of this improvements allow ARAO to lower the operative working time and costs and consequently to improve the efficiency of the performing of the institutional radioactive waste management. Therefore the implementation of the JSMP application enables ARAO to meet the requirements for performing effective and technologically adequate management system of the institutional radioactive waste in Slovenia. Application allows easy browsing of the history of the each individual package. Beside all above mentioned benefits it has to be clear that the implementation of JSMP application was not completely smoothly. There were many hard and soft barriers that had direct influence on the implementation success. ARAO employees did tremendously amount of work to transform the old database (historical data about the waste packages already stored in the CSF) into the form of new database and entering this data into new JSMP application. Some human mistakes were made during entering the historical data into JSMP application and its identification together with the correction have been extremely time consuming task. Another unpleasantness during the development of the JSMP application was connected with changes in the legislative requirements for electronic reporting into CERAO. The result was that this functionality was upgraded few months later after the JSMP application was implemented with additional indispensable costs. In three years of using the JSMP application ARAO almost have not needed the support of external IT service resulting the JSMP application system errors. All support of IT service ARAO have been used for small corrections related with the mistakes in data entering and small upgrades and improvements. It was very important that JSMP application architecture structure is opened for the future necessary improvements and upgrades. 80% of employee immediately grabbed the challenge with whole enthusiasm; other 20% needed special motivation, stimulation and monitoring. The barriers that have been identified among ARAO employee during implementation of JSMP application and testing phase can be attributed to fear of change, vagueness of subject and desire to preserve the status quo. SWOT analysis shown in the table below describes strengths, opportunities, threats and weaknesses of the implementation of the JSMP application. Important achievement is that the most weaknesses and threats were successfully managed; but some of them still exist.

9 707.9 Table 2: SWOT analysis of the implementation of the JSMP application STRENGTHS Correctly chosen software development live-cycle model. All JSMP application errors were identified during the validation tests. Skilled software engineering experts with experiences and know-how about software engineering process assured design of the application without any significant errors after validations phase. Preparation of interactive graphical user interface prototype. Two weeks training for the ARAO s employees. During this training, IT experts train users how to work with the new application. Exhaustive and exact functional specification documentation. Effective and open communication with all involved parties during development of the application (ARAO employee, IT experts, external radwaste experts). Well-known IT company with references in the Information Business System development guarantied quality service for further upgrading of application, support and maintenance. OPPORTUNITIES Increased efficiency in performing of the institutional radioactive waste management. Informatisation of ARAO main business process with modern technologies. The guidelines for further development of the operational system are already known. CONCLUSION WEAKNESSES Constraint for the further maintenance of the application to contract with the same IT company that design tailormade JSMP application (dependence, expensive). THREATS Changes in legislation. Influence of the financial and economical crisis, possible bankruptcy of the IT company that design the JSMP application or big changes in their management and human resources. Major changes of human resources in ARAO. Formally, every system can be viewed as a collection of functional components performing in interaction to achieve an objective or to perform a task within defined boundaries. If a system is to be controlled, the essential feature is feedback information about output deviations from target values, brought back to the input side. Feedback information is essential part of every Information Business System. Newly developed Information Business System for the management of institutional radioactive waste is always

10 in dynamic interaction with its surrounding, determined by a constant flow of resources into the systems, and flow of system outputs, intended and incidental, out into the environment. On the operational level, information/digitalization of the institutional radioactive waste management is concerned with optimizing and controlling the use of ARAO resources (indirectly taxpayer money) to achieve more efficient public service. Within the process of the development and implementation of the JSMP application it has been confirmed that the most important ARAO s resources are knowledgeable, experienced and resourceful people and agency capabilities and awareness on how to perform the know-how! After three years of extensive usage it can be concluded that JSMP application provide an efficient platform for information management according to the regulatory authority requirements and ARAO management needs.
